What to Expect

Working in the kitchen industry typically involves fast-paced environments where teamwork is essential. Expect to work flexible hours, including evenings and weekends. Physical demands may include standing for long periods, lifting heavy items, and maintaining cleanliness. Adapting to the busy atmosphere and ensuring high standards of food safety are crucial parts of the job.

You can find various positions such as kitchen assistants, chefs, and kitchen helpers. Each role has different responsibilities and skill requirements.

While some positions require experience, many entry-level roles are available for those willing to learn. Training is often provided.

Working hours can vary, but expect to work evenings, weekends, and holidays. Flexibility is often required.

EU citizens do not need a work permit to work in the Netherlands. However, non-EU citizens must apply for a work visa through their employer.

Benefits may include paid holidays, health insurance, and opportunities for professional development. Check your CAO for specific entitlements.

You can obtain a BSN by registering at your local municipality office. Bring identification and proof of your address in the Netherlands.
